It was a night of glitz, glamour and gospel when the 28th Annual Stellar Awards show made its presentation this Saturday night at the Gaylord Opryland Hotel. The show was sold out several days before airing for the first time live on the GMC Television Network. Hosting this year’s event was multi-award winning performers Kirk Franklin and Mary Mary.
This year’s big winners included the Rev. Charles Jenkins, Marvin Sapp and co-hosts Mary Mary.
The evening was filled with top-notch glamour, starting with red carpet appearances and performances throughout the evening included that included a minus dreadlocked Tye Tribbett, Israel Houghton & New Breed, Jason Nelson, Anita Wilson, Y’Anna Crawley, Kierra Sheard, Byron Cage, The Kurt Carr Singers, Marvin Winans, The Walls, Shirley Caesar, Tamela Mann, Marvin Sapp, Dottie Peoples, Pastor Charles Jenkins & the Fellowship Chicago Choir, Maurelle Brown Clark and LeAndria Johnson.
Other special performances from the surviving members of the legendary Caravans, including Delores Washington, Dorothy Norwood and Shirley Caesar who each paid tribute to their friend the late Inez Andrews by singing her popular song, ”Mary Don’t You Weep.”

ARTIST OF THE YEAR: Marvin Sapp, I Win, Verity Gospel Music Group
SONG OF THE YEAR: Charles Jenkins, Awesome, The Best of Both Worlds, Inspired People
MALE VOCALIST OF THE YEAR: Marvin Sapp, I Win, Verity Gospel Music Group
ALBERTINA WALKER FEMALE VOCALIST OF THE YEAR: Kierra Sheard, Free, Karew Records
GROUP/DUO OF THE YEAR: Mary, Mary, Go Get It, My Block, Columbia Records
NEW ARTIST OF THE YEAR: Le’Andria Johnson, The Awakening of Le’Andria Johnson, Music World Gospel
CONTEMPORARY GROUP/DUO OF THE YEAR: Mary, Mary, Go Get It, My Block, Columbia Records
TRADITIONAL GROUP/DUO OF THE YEAR: The Williams Brothers, Live At Hard Rock, Part 1, Blackberry Records.
CONTEMPORARY MALE OF THE YEAR: Fred Hammond, God Love & Romance, Verity Gospel Music Group
TRADITIONAL MALE OF THE YEAR: Marvin Sapp, I Win, Verity Gospel Music Group
CONTEMPORARY FEMALE OF THE YEAR: Le’Andria Johnson, The Awakening of Le’Andria Johnson, Music World Gospel
TRADITIONAL FEMALE OF THE YEAR: Vanessa Bell Armstrong, Timesless, Music World Gospel
CONTEMPORARY CD OF THE YEAR: Mary, Mary, Go Get It, My Block, Columbia Records
TRADITIONAL CD OF THE YEAR: Marvin Sapp, I Win, Verity Gospel Music Group
URBAN/INSPIRATIONAL SINGLE OR PERFORMANCE OF THE YEAR: Mary, Mary, Go Get It, My Block, Columbia Records
MUSIC VIDEO OF THE YEAR – SHORT FORMAT: Darren Grant, Go Get It, My Block, Columbia Records
TRADITIONAL CHOIR OF THE YEAR: Charles Jenkins & Fellowship Chicago, The Best of Both Worlds, Inspired People
CHILDRENS PROJECT OF THE YEAR: Anointed By God, Anointed By God, One Voice Media
QUARTET OF THE YEAR: The William Brothers, Live At The Hard Rock-Part 1, Blackberry Records
RECORDED MUSIC PACKAGING OF THE YEAR: Charles Jenkins, The Best of Both Worlds, Inspired People
PRAISE AND WORSHIP CD OF THE YEAR: Jason Nelson, Shifting The Atmosphere, Verity Gospel Music Group. Other special awards to:
James Cleveland Lifetime Achievement Award: Kurt Carr
Thomas A. Dorsey Most Notable Achievement Award: Bishop T.D. Jakes

Ambassador Dr. Bobby Jones Legends Award: Inez Andrews
